Understanding the Basics of Xbox and Microsoft Accounts

Before diving into the connection process, it’s essential to understand the difference between an Xbox account and a Microsoft account. The Xbox account is specifically designed for gaming on Xbox consoles, while the Microsoft account is a broader email account that provides access to a range of Microsoft services, from Outlook to OneDrive.

When you create an Xbox account, you’re actually creating a Microsoft account, which allows you to sync your gaming experiences seamlessly across all devices. Therefore, if you want to connect your Xbox account to your PC, you will primarily be working with your Microsoft account.

Preparing to Connect Your Xbox Account to PC

Before proceeding with the connection, there are a few prerequisites:

Your Device Requirements

To connect your Xbox account to your PC, you will need:

  1. A PC running Windows 10 or later.
  2. An Xbox account with an active Xbox Game Pass subscription (optional but recommended).
  3. The Xbox app installed on your PC.

Installing and Setting Up Xbox App

To get started, ensure you’ve downloaded the Xbox app. Here’s how:

  1. Open Microsoft Store: Click on the Microsoft Store icon in your taskbar or search for it in the Start menu.
  2. Search for the Xbox App: In the search bar, type “Xbox”.
  3. Install the App: Find the Xbox app and click “Get” or “Install.”

Once installed, launch the app to begin the account connection process.

Step-by-Step Guide to Connect Your Xbox Account to Your PC

Now that you have everything in place, let’s walk through the steps to connect your Xbox account to your PC:

Step 1: Sign in to the Xbox App

  1. Open the Xbox App: Launch the Xbox app on your PC.
  2. Sign In: Click on the “Sign In” button located at the top right corner of the app.
  3. Enter Your Credentials: Input your Microsoft account email and password associated with your Xbox account.

Step 2: Link Your Accounts

Once you’ve signed in:

  1. Access Settings: Click on your profile picture in the app, then select “Settings” from the dropdown menu.
  2. Linked Accounts: Navigate to the “Linked Accounts” section.
  3. Link Your Xbox Account: Follow the prompts to link your Xbox account to your Microsoft account, if necessary. This will typically be automatic since both are tied to your email, but double-checking ensures you’re seeing your game library.

Step 3: Enable Cross-Play Settings

For most games, enabling cross-play settings is crucial:

  1. Within Game Settings: Launch a game that supports cross-play.
  2. Access the Settings Menu: Look for the options related to online multiplayer or cross-play.
  3. Enable Cross-Play: Ensure the cross-play option is turned on so that you can play with friends on Xbox.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Even with the best intentions, sometimes things may go awry. If you encounter issues while connecting your Xbox account to your PC, consider the following troubleshooting tips:

Verify Account Credentials

Ensure that the email and password entered during the sign-in process are correct. If you suspect your account is compromised, change your Microsoft account password immediately.

Update Windows and Xbox App

  1. Windows Updates: Ensure your PC is updated with the latest version of Windows. Go to “Settings” > “Update & Security” > “Windows Update” and check for updates.
  2. Update the Xbox App: Open the Microsoft Store, and check for any Xbox app updates.

Check Network Connectivity

Ensure you have a stable internet connection. If your connection is weak or sporadic, it may hinder the ability to connect your accounts.

Utilizing Xbox Game Pass

One of the best features of connecting your Xbox account to your PC is access to Xbox Game Pass. This subscription service opens up a world of gaming opportunities. Here’s how to make the most out of it:

Accessing Game Pass Library

To browse through the Xbox Game Pass titles:

  1. Open the Xbox App: Make sure you’re signed in.
  2. Navigate to Game Pass: In the left sidebar, click on “Game Pass”.
  3. Explore Games: You can filter games by genre, newly added, or popular titles.

Installing Games

Installing games is straightforward:

  1. Select a Game: Click on the title you want to install.
  2. Install: Click the “Install” button, and the game will download to your PC.

How do I connect my Xbox account to my PC?

To connect your Xbox account to your PC, start by downloading the Xbox app from the Microsoft Store, if you haven’t already. Once the app is installed, open it and sign in with your Microsoft account, which is the same account linked to your Xbox profile. If you have not signed up for a Microsoft account yet, you can create one directly in the app.

After signing in, your Xbox account will be automatically linked to the app, and you can explore various features, including the game library and social options. Ensure that your Windows operating system is updated to the latest version for the best compatibility. Once connected, you can enjoy titles from Xbox Game Pass or other purchased games seamlessly.

What should I do if I forget my Microsoft account password?

If you forget your Microsoft account password, you can easily reset it by visiting the Microsoft account recovery page. Click on the “Forgot my password” link, and you will be guided through a series of steps to verify your identity. This usually involves sending a code to your registered email or phone number, which you will use to regain access to your account.

Once you’ve received the verification code, enter it on the website, and you will be prompted to create a new password. Make sure to choose a strong, memorable password to enhance your account’s security. After resetting your password, you can proceed to connect your Xbox account to your PC without any issues.

Can I use the same Xbox account on multiple PCs?

Yes, you can use the same Xbox account on multiple PCs. This flexibility allows you to access your game library and play your titles from any compatible device. Once you install the Xbox app on a new PC and sign in with your Microsoft account, all your games, achievements, and friends will be available just as they are on your primary system.

Be mindful, however, that some games might have specific installation limits or require unique licenses, particularly if they were purchased through platforms other than the Microsoft Store. Generally, as long as you are logged into the Xbox app with your account, you can freely switch between devices while keeping your gaming progress intact.
